Welcome to the Stormline support rotation! When the Gale fan-out service pushes weather alerts, each region gets its own queue, and retries happen automatically for up to an hour. If a customer reports missing alerts, check the fan-out dashboard first — nine times out of ten it's a muted region. You can query the Gale admin endpoint yourself from the support console; it authenticates with a shared service key, shown just below.

API key for yahig-tadup: kto7_ubizbYm

Subject: DR drill scope — soft deletes in the Wrenbury orders table

Hello,

For next week's disaster-recovery drill, we'll validate that soft-deleted rows in the Wrenbury orders table survive a full restore with their deleted_at markers intact. Your role is to confirm no tombstoned orders reappear as active after replay. The restore snapshot is held in the sealed Ferncliff vault; you'll unseal it yourself during the exercise. The recovery passphrase for that vault is included directly below.

recovery phrase for fawif-tajeg: norael-aldmir-casir-brivan-ulaion

Step 4 — Shipping Driftpane (our big-file diff viewer)

Build the chunked-rendering bundle first; Driftpane streams diffs in 2MB slices, so don't skip the worker assets or huge files will just spin forever. Run the smoke test against the 500MB fixture in the perf folder — if scrolling stutters, bump the slice cache before releasing. When everything passes, you're ready to sign the artifact. Paste the deploy key below so the uploader can authenticate.

deploy key for kagup-bageg: bky4_6i6U

## Deploying the Gatewick Proctor Queue

Deploys are pretty painless: push to main, wait for the pipeline, then watch the queue drain dashboard for five minutes. If candidates pile up mid-exam, roll back first and ask questions later — the queue replays safely. Everything the workers care about lives in one config block, shown here for reference.

settings of bafof-yagef:
JOROX_PIN=8740
JOROX_TENANT=pelox
JOROX_METRICS_HOST=metrics.jorox.qorvelworks.internal
JOROX_SEAL=seal_c78f63c1
JOROX_STANDBY_TEAM=norax